9. Past Simple | Grammar | EnglishClub
Past Simple. The Past Simple tense is sometimes called the “preterite tense”. We can use several tenses and forms to talk about the past, but the Past Simple tense is the one we use most often. In this lesson we look at the structure and use of the Past Simple tense, followed by a quiz to check your understanding. How do we make the Past Simple …

10. The Simple Past Tense – SlideShare
29/08/2007 · The Simple Past Tense 1. The Simple Past Tense Yesterday I went for a swim. 2. Affirmative: The past tense of regular verbs is formed by adding – d or – ed to the base form of the verb. I work ed in a shop last year, I live d in a big house when I was younger. PAST SIMPLE TENSE: REGULAR VERBS I work ed hard last weekend 3.
